GREEN v. STATE

No. 552, 2019.

238 A.3d 160 (2020)

Todd GREEN, Defendant Below, Appellant, v. STATE of Delaware, Plaintiff Below, Appellee.

Supreme Court of Delaware.

Decided: August 17, 2020.


Attorney(s) appearing for the Case

Benjamin S. Gifford, IV, Esquire , Wilmington, Delaware for Appellant Todd Green.

John R. Williams, Esquire , Department of Justice, Dover, Delaware for Appellee State of Delaware.

Before VALIHURA, VAUGHN, and TRAYNOR, Justices.


Todd Green appeals from the Superior Court's denial of his motion for postconviction relief under Superior Court Criminal Rule 61.
